Aden Port: Aden Port is the main commercial port in Yemen, located in the southern part of the country. It serves as a crucial gateway for imports and exports, handling a wide range of goods including food, fuel, and other commodities. The port has modern facilities for container handling and storage, making it a key hub for international trade in the region.
Hodeidah Port: Hodeidah Port is another major port in Yemen, situated on the Red Sea coast. It is the country's largest port in terms of cargo volume and plays a vital role in facilitating the import of essential goods such as food and fuel. The port has modern container terminals and storage facilities, making it a key distribution point for goods destined for other parts of Yemen.
Mukalla Port: Mukalla Port is a strategic port located in the Hadhramaut Governorate in eastern Yemen. It primarily serves as a gateway for the export of Yemeni goods such as agricultural products and fish. The port is equipped with modern facilities for handling bulk cargo and has a fishing harbor that supports the local fishing industry.
Mokha Port: Mokha Port is an ancient port located on the Red Sea coast of Yemen. It has historically been a key trading center for coffee and other goods. While the port's commercial significance has declined in recent years, it still plays a role in facilitating the export of Yemeni coffee and other agricultural products.
Nishtun Port: Nishtun Port is a small port located in the Socotra Archipelago, a UNESCO World Heritage Site off the coast of Yemen. The port primarily serves the local population and supports the island's fishing industry. Nishtun Port also plays a role in facilitating tourism to the picturesque island.
Other ports in Yemen include Salif Port, Balhaf Port, and Ras Isa Terminal.

For container transportation from Yemen to Bermuda, various factors come into play. The size of the shipping container, the type of goods to be shipped, distance of the destination, and the shipping method (either Full Container Load or Less than Container Load) all directly affect the cost.
When shipping cargo from Yemen to Bermuda, the average transit time for sea freight can vary depending on several factors such as the type of cargo, shipping route, and mode of transportation. Generally, sea freight from Yemen to Bermuda can take anywhere from 20 to 45 days. Factors like weather conditions, port congestion, and vessel schedules can also impact transit times.
